This Manfrotto Spring Clamp is pretty obvious in its intended use. Use the clamp on appropriate surfaces/areas and use the socket for the umbrella adapter swivel to mount your hotshoe flash for better lighting options.
Umbrella adapters allow you to mount your hotshoe flash (plus an umbrella, if so desired) to light stands, clamps, etc. for off-camera lighting.
